BALTIMORE, MD—Early Thursday morning, at approximately 3:03 a.m., Southeast District patrol officers were called to a local hospital following the report of a walk-in shooting victim.
Upon arrival, officers discovered a 36-year-old man with gunshot wounds that were determined to be non-life-threatening.
Currently, the exact location of the shooting remains unknown to investigators.
Authorities are requesting that anyone with information about the incident contact Southeast District detectives at 410-396-2422 or Metro Crime Stoppers at 1-866-7Lockup.
